Why Sweat-Wicking Fabrics Are Essential in Sportswear
During intense activity, the body produces sweat as a natural cooling mechanism. Without the right fabrics, this moisture stays trapped, causing discomfort, irritation, and distraction. Sweat-wicking fabrics are engineered to pull moisture away from the skin and transfer it to the fabric’s surface, where it can evaporate quickly.
Factories achieve this through:
-
Capillary Action Technology: Special fibers draw sweat away from the skin.
-
Microfiber Structures: Enhanced surface area speeds up moisture transport.
-
Blended Yarns: Polyester-spandex and nylon combinations balance performance with stretch.
For sportswear brands, this technology ensures garments feel fresh and lightweight, even during long training sessions or competitions.
Quick-Dry Fabrics: Staying Light, Wash After Wash
Quick-dry fabrics complement sweat-wicking by releasing absorbed moisture faster than traditional textiles. This dual effect keeps garments light and prevents the “heavy” feeling that comes with damp clothing. Beyond athletic use, quick-dry properties reduce washing downtime, making them ideal for both daily training gear and professional uniforms.
Advanced sportswear fabric factories achieve quick-dry performance through:
-
Hydrophobic Coatings: Prevent fibers from retaining excess water.
-
Cross-Section Fibers: Engineered yarn shapes that increase airflow and evaporation.
-
High-Tech Dyeing Methods: Ensuring that quick-dry performance doesn’t compromise colorfastness.
This balance of technology ensures fabrics remain resilient, delivering performance after dozens of wash cycles.
